For sales leads. Kellway Dynamics alleges our Ostermark suite infringes their Fernhall scheduling patent. We deny it. Status: mediation scheduled; injunction risk assessed as low by counsel Theo Bram. Do not discuss with customers. If prospects raise it, use the approved one-line response and escalate to legal. Existing Ostermark contracts are unaffected; renewals proceed normally. Pipeline in the Derrow Valley region may see delays. The confidential commercial plan sits directly below this page.

confidential, kagep-kahof: Druokax Systems plans to lower the Ulaath list price by 53 percent in March.

Scope: retire crontab entries on the Drayline hosts; replace with Spindleworks workflow definitions. Rollout gated behind the release train; no dual-running beyond one cycle. Failure mode: duplicate execution during cutover, mitigated by idempotency keys. Rollback is config-only. Ship order: ingest jobs first, billing last. Tuning constants for the cutover window:

constants for bawif-kawif:
QUOTAS = {
    "ulaael": 5,
    "holael": 10,
}

### Changed defaults — circuit breaker for Pondera upstream

Heads up for review: we got tired of Pondera's afternoon brownouts taking Larkspin down with them, so the breaker now trips faster and recovers more cautiously. Half-open probes are limited to one request. Nothing changes for callers except fewer cascading timeouts. The new defaults shipping with this PR are as follows.

config for tajof-yaguf:
[istox]
team = aldius
access_code = ac_29be1b
owner = holok.praix
host = istox.zarqelsoft.test
port = 11211
peer = novath.olvarqio.example
salt = 983a9dc6
pin = 4652